What is direct thermal path metal core PCBs?
LEDs Chip Thermal Pads solder to the Aluminum or Copper substrate directly,
No dielectric between LEDs heat out pads and the Metal core.
Means,thermal resistance is very small and,
Thermal conductivity could be 175 W/m.k ( direct to aluminum) to 385 W/m.k( direct to copper ).
The regular MCPCB is 1.0 w/m.k
